11 youngsters arrested for throwing stones at police officers after ‘Jewish terrorist’ court ruling

Protests in Haifa 
By: Sarah Weiss

(Scroll down for video) Eleven youngsters were arrested and will be charged with assaulting a police officer, after they allegedly threw stones at police officers after a court sentenced several Arab men to jail for killing a Jewish terrorist, according to police reports in Israel.

Haifa Police said that rioting is continuing in Haifa, and eleven young Arab men were arrested after they were accused of rioting and stone throwing.

The eleven men were brought before a Magistrate's Court judge, and 3 suspects were remanded into custody. The other eight suspects were released on bail.

Police said that one of those arrested is the popular Arab figure Mohammed Kanaan. He is being accused of assaulting a police officer and failing to obey a police officer. The other suspects committed rioting in a public place, illegal gathering and assaulting a police officer.

As we reported earlier, seven men were arrested, charged and convicted of attempted manslaughter after they were accused of a vigilante attack against a Jewish terrorist, according to court proceedings in Israel.

The Haifa District Court on Thursday, sentenced seven Arab-Israeli men to a maximum of two years in prison for the 2005 murder of Jewish terrorist Eden Natan-Zada.

Six men were sentenced to prison terms of between 11 and 24 months and the seventh received a suspended sentence. All men participated in the beating death of an Israeli soldier, who eight years ago opened fire inside a bus, killing four people and wounding 17 others.

Throughout the trial the suspects had maintained their innocence, claiming that they had acted in self defense.

"Vengeance is for God, and punishment is the function of the judicial authorities," the court said.

In total, nine people were arrested for disorderly conduct in the incident.

Police said that Arab Israelis began to riot after the sentencing claiming that the court showed an anti-Arab bias.
